How Common Is The Last Name Casbas? popularity and diffusion
The last name Casbas is the 575,362nd most prevalent surname worldwide It is held by approximately 1 in 13,322,753 people. This surname is mostly found in Europe, where 94 percent of Casbas are found; 65 percent are found in Southwestern Europe and 65 percent are found in Iberian Europe.
This surname is most commonly used in Spain, where it is carried by 354 people, or 1 in 132,068. In Spain it is primarily concentrated in: Aragon, where 48 percent live, Catalonia, where 34 percent live and Madrid, where 6 percent live. Beside Spain Casbas occurs in 5 countries. It is also common in France, where 29 percent live and Argentina, where 5 percent live.
